‘To let’ signs have appeared at Stroud restaurant Tomari-Gi.

The popular Japanese eatery on George Street closed last week, but Stroud Times understands the business could relocate to the Five Valleys Shopping Centre.

However, Dransfield Properties, who own the Five Valleys Shopping Centre have said they have no knowledge of any such move, with social media reports suggesting the business could now move to Stroud High Street.
